Eight years after the adoption of the world's first Glacier Protection Law, Argentina's Glacier Institute (the IANIGLA) finally released the official version of Argentina's first complete glacier inventory. The IANIGLA has registered 16,968 glaciers, which are now precisely identified and fully protected by Argentina's Glacier Law, the first of its kind anywhere on the planet.
